Transaction 91b28ea96a044976d92af6cbd59ef28d1b16488dc07e4b4a2de59f55091d6707

2 Input
2 Outputs
  • 91b28ea96a044976d92af6cbd59ef28d1b16488dc07e4b4a2de59f55091d6707:0
  • value  888459
    address  13KpYcyB3sS4wyCFSHxaRGGx1RRzFuGAbU
  • 91b28ea96a044976d92af6cbd59ef28d1b16488dc07e4b4a2de59f55091d6707:1
  • value  650000
    address  3DnByQ6HVhcFLj452uxWDZ7ZefSxQ6SsWE